Purchase Card definition

Purchase Card means a payment method whereby employees of the Town are empowered to deal directly with vendors for low value acquisitions, using a credit card issued by a bank or major credit card provider. Generally, a pre-established credit limit is established for each card issued. The card may facilitate on-line ordering from pre- approved vendors under contract;
Purchase Card means a bank provided charge card that empowers staff to obtain services without the need for paper requisitions, purchase orders or invoices (where applicable).

Purchase Card means a bank provided charge card that empowers staff to obtain goods without the need for paper requisitions, purchase orders or invoices.
Purchase Card. (see also Ghost Card) means a payment method whereby employees of the Town authorized by C.A.O., Commissioner and/or Director are empowered to deal directly with Contractors for LVP purchases, subject to the exceptions stated in both Schedule “E” Position Exceptions, using a credit card issued by a bank or major credit card provider. Generally, a pre- established credit limit is established for each card issued. The cards enable e-Procurement and facilitate on-line ordering, frequently from pre-approved Contractors under contracts. The Purchase Card may be used for additional usage, in addition to Low Values Purchases, as described in the Purchase Card Program Policies and Procedures.
